Pros

The culture is pretty relaxed, the company is genuinely invested in growing your skill set and marketability as a developer, and working as a contractor has a way of insulating you from the corporate politics and financial woes of your clients.

Cons

Pay and benefits are mediocre. As a result, lot of folks will struggle to be comfortable working here indefinitely.
